
Laszlo Hanyecz's legendary pizza purchase for 10,000 bitcoins remains a cornerstone of crypto culture today. In 2026, as BTC continues its upward trajectory, discussions swirl around the implications of his choice and what it means for Bitcoin's journey.
In May 2010, Hanyecz spent 10,000 bitcoins on two pizzas, an act now revered in the crypto world. This purchase marked a pivotal moment that pushed Bitcoin into the public eye and raised interest in digital currencies.
